Important Features to Look For

When seeking a quality potato ricer, consider the following features to ensure you get the best tool for your culinary endeavors. These features include materials, design, and functionality. 1. Material: Choose a ricer constructed from durable stainless steel or aluminum, as these materials are both sturdy and resistant to corrosion. 2. Design: Look for a ricer with a comfortable handle and a simple, intuitive design that allows for easy operation. The mechanism should evenly press the potatoes through the holes to create a consistent texture. 3. Handle: A secure, ergonomic handle will make the ricer comfortable to use and help prevent slips during operation. 4. Hole Size: Check the hole size to determine which ricer is suitable for the type of potato and the desired texture you are aiming for. Different models come with varying hole sizes, so choose one with the best fit for your needs.

How do I clean my potato ricer?

Cleaning your potato ricer is a simple process that ensures your appliance remains in top working order. First, disassemble the ricer by removing any parts that can be separated, such as the handle or the base. Next, wash the parts in warm, soapy water, making sure to remove any residual potato puree or skin.

If your potato ricer is dishwasher-safe, you can place the parts in the top rack of the dishwasher for a thorough cleaning. However, it’s always a good idea to consult the manufacturer’s instructions to ensure that your ricer is dishwasher-safe and to follow any specific cleaning guidelines. Once the parts are clean, reassemble the ricer and it’s ready for use in your next culinary adventure.
